MDPI - Open Access Author Publishing Charge (APC) Discount
MDPI are providing a 10% discount on Article Processing Charges for Open Access Publishing
Please note: this is NOT a Read & Publish Agreement, simply a discount on APC fees
MDPI journals eligible for the discount
MDPI has not excluded any of their journals from this discount.
Article types eligible for the discount
Submitted manuscripts containing original research are eligible for the discount
Affiliated authors also receive a 10% discount on charges associated with open access book publishing with MDPI
Limitations on the discount
Only one discount per paper, and the discount cannot be combined with other available discounts (e.g., discount vouchers, or society membership discounts)
Any staff or student affiliated with the university qualify for the discount
Creative Commons Licenses
All MDPI journals publish under the Creative Commons Attribution License: CC BY.
